Apple Tart Fine with Moo’d Vanilla Gelato
Prep Time15 Minutes
Servings4
Cook Time20 Minutes
Ingredients
250g puff pastry
3 granny smith apples
20g unsalted SuperValu butter, melted
1-2 tbsp golden caster
Icing sugar to dust
Vanilla Gelato
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 190°C (375°F).
- Roll out the puff pastry thinly on a lightly floured surface to a 2mm thickness.
- Using a 22 cm plate, cut out 1 round and place on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
- Prick the pastry all over with a fork to stop it from puffing up.
- Sprinkle a bit of the raw sugar on top of the pastry.
- Peel, core, and thinly slice the apples into circles.
- Arrange the apple slices in a circle on top of the pastry disc, overlapping them slightly.
- Place a few pieces of apple rings in the middle to finish.
- Brush them with softened butter and sprinkle with another layer of raw sugar.
- Bake the tarts for 15-18 minutes until the pastry is cooked. Keep an eye on them to avoid overcooking.
- Add another sprinkle of raw sugar and place under the grill for a few minutes to caramelize, or use a blow torch. Watch carefully as the sugar will caramelize very quickly.
- Dust with icing sugar. Serve the tarts warm, with a scoop of Moo’d Vanilla Gelato.
